Matthew 22:41-46 - David's Son And Lord

Matthew 22:41-46

41 Before the Pharisees separated, Jesus put this question to them-- 42 "What do you think about the Christ? Whose son is he?" "David's," they said.

43 "How is it, then," Jesus replied, "that David, speaking under inspiration, calls him 'lord,' in the passage-

44 'The Lord said to my Lord: "Sit at my right hand, Until I put thy enemies beneath thy feet"'?

45 Since, then, David calls him 'lord,' how is he David's son?" 46 No one could say a word in answer; nor did any one after that day venture to question him further.

Mark 12:35-37

35 While Jesus was teaching in the Temple Courts, he asked: "How is it that the Teachers of the Law say that the Christ is to be David's son? 36 David said himself, speaking under the inspiration of the Holy Spirit-- 'The Lord said to my lord: "Sit at my right hand, Until I put thy enemies beneath thy feet.'"

37 David himself calls him 'lord,' how comes it, then, that he is to be his son?" The mass of the people listened to Jesus with delight.

Luke 20:41-44

41 But Jesus said to them: "How is it that people say that the Christ is to be David's son? 42 For David, in the Book of Psalms, says himself--'The Lord said to my lord: "Sit at my right hand, 43 Until I put they enemies as a stool for thy feet."'

44 David, then, calls him 'lord,' so how is he David's son?"
